The Classic Car History Timeline: From Horseless Carriage to Collectible Icon
The history of the automobile spans less than 140 years, and yet within that remarkably compressed timeline lies an epic narrative of technological revolution, social transformation, artistic achievement, industrial warfare conducted on a global scale, and the emergence of a culture of collecting and preservation that has elevated individual automobiles to the status of fine art. The classic car—the automobile elevated from mere transportation to object of desire, preservation, and collecting—traces its lineage through distinct eras, each one defined by the interplay of engineering advances, design philosophies, economic conditions, and cultural forces that shaped not only the cars themselves but the communities that formed around them. This timeline traces that evolution from the earliest days of the horseless carriage through the golden age of coachbuilding, the post-war sports-car boom, the muscle-car wars, the supercar emergence of the late twentieth century, and into the modern era where cars built within living memory are already recognized as the classics of tomorrow. Understanding this timeline is essential not merely for appreciating the individual cars but for grasping why certain models, certain eras, and certain marques command the values, the reverence, and the passionate following that they do. Every classic car is a product of its moment, shaped by the technology, the aesthetics, and the cultural assumptions of the society that created it, and the timeline reveals those connections with clarity and force.
The Pioneer Era: 1886 to 1918
The automobile was born, by the consensus of most historians, in 1886—a remarkable year in which two independent inventors working in different German cities created the first vehicles that were recognizably automobiles rather than motorized adaptations of existing carriages. Karl Benz patented his three-wheeled Patent-Motorwagen in Mannheim, a machine that was designed from its inception as a unified whole, with its single-cylinder engine, chassis, and body conceived as an integrated system. Independently and nearly simultaneously, Gottlieb Daimler and his collaborator Wilhelm Maybach fitted a high-speed internal-combustion engine to a carriage in Cannstatt, near Stuttgart, creating the first four-wheeled automobile. The Benz was arguably the more visionary design, a purpose-built automobile rather than an adapted carriage, and in 1888, Bertha Benz—Karl’s wife, an extraordinary figure whose contribution to automotive history has only recently received the recognition it deserves—completed the first long-distance automobile journey, driving 106 kilometers from Mannheim to Pforzheim with her two sons to demonstrate the practicality of her husband’s invention. Along the way, she invented brake linings by having a cobbler fit leather pads to the wooden brake blocks, and she unclogged a blocked fuel line with her hatpin—a demonstration of resourcefulness that every stranded motorist has channeled in the decades since.
France became the center of early automotive development, with Panhard et Levassor and Peugeot licensing the Daimler engine and beginning series production of automobiles. The Système Panhard—front-mounted engine driving the rear wheels through a sliding-gear transmission, with the engine in front, the passengers in the middle, and the driven wheels at the rear—established the fundamental architectural template that would dominate automobile design for the next century and beyond. The 1901 Mercedes 35 HP, designed by Wilhelm Maybach for Daimler-Motoren-Gesellschaft at the behest of the entrepreneur and diplomat Emil Jellinek, who named the car after his daughter Mercédès, is widely recognized as the first modern automobile. It introduced the pressed-steel chassis, the honeycomb radiator that made reliable engine cooling possible for the first time, the gate-change gearbox, and a low center of gravity achieved by placing the engine low in the frame—a complete departure from the high, unstable carriage-derived designs that preceded it.
In 1906, Rolls-Royce introduced the 40/50 HP, which would become immortalized as the Silver Ghost after the publicity-generating 1907 15,000-mile reliability trial that established the company’s reputation for standards of engineering and quality that no other manufacturer could match. The Silver Ghost was not the fastest car of its era, nor the most powerful, nor the most innovative in any single dimension. It was simply the best-built car in the world, with a level of attention to materials, machining, and assembly that created an experience of mechanical refinement that felt almost supernatural to buyers accustomed to the vibration, noise, and unreliability of lesser automobiles. In 1908, Henry Ford introduced the Model T, a car that was not designed to be the best but to be the most accessible. The moving assembly line, implemented at Ford’s Highland Park factory in 1913, reduced the time required to assemble a Model T chassis from 12.5 hours to 93 minutes, and the price of a Model T touring car fell from $850 to $260 over the course of the car’s production run. By 1927, when the last Model T rolled off the line, 15 million had been produced—a record that stood until the Volkswagen Beetle surpassed it in 1972.
Bugatti, founded in 1909 by the Italian-born, French-naturalized Ettore Bugatti in the Alsatian town of Molsheim—then part of Germany, now firmly French—produced the diminutive, jewel-like Type 13, which won the 1921 Voiturette Grand Prix at Brescia and gave the model its enduring nickname. The Type 13 established Bugatti’s philosophy of combining engineering excellence with aesthetic beauty, a philosophy that would reach its ultimate expression in the Type 35 Grand Prix car and the Type 57 Atlantic of the 1930s.
The Golden Age: 1919 to 1939
The interwar period represents what many knowledgeable observers consider the absolute zenith of the coachbuilder’s art—an era when the automobile chassis served as the canvas upon which independent artists in wood, metal, leather, and paint created bodies of breathtaking individuality and beauty. The great coachbuilding firms—Barker, Hooper, H.J. Mulliner, Park Ward, and James Young in Britain; Figoni et Falaschi, Saoutchik, Franay, Labourdette, and Chapron in France; Castagna and Touring in Italy; Murphy, Bohman and Schwartz, Derham, and Brewster in the United States—created automobile bodies that were nothing less than works of applied art, each one tailored to the tastes, the requirements, and the social station of its first owner.
The 1920s saw Bugatti introduce the Type 35 in 1924, a car that would go on to win over 1,000 races during its career—a record unmatched by any other racing car in history—and that established the template for the Bugatti racing cars that would follow. The Bentley 3 Litre, introduced in 1921, and its successors the 4½ Litre and Speed Six, driven by the wealthy and fearless young men known collectively as the Bentley Boys, won the 24 Hours of Le Mans in 1924, 1927, 1928, 1929, and 1930, establishing a British racing tradition at La Sarthe that endures to this day. The 1930 Mercedes-Benz 770, known as the Grosser Mercedes, established the template for the state limousine of staggering presence and cost that would define the upper limits of the automobile for decades.
The 1930s produced cars of extraordinary beauty and ever-increasing mechanical sophistication. The 1934 Citroën Traction Avant pioneered front-wheel drive and unitary body construction for mass-produced vehicles, innovations that would not become universal in the industry for another half-century. The Chrysler Airflow of the same year introduced aerodynamic streamlining to the American market, though its radical styling—a complete departure from the upright, radiator-forward aesthetic that defined the era—was too advanced for contemporary tastes and the car was a commercial failure that taught Detroit a cautionary lesson about the pace at which public taste evolves. The Bugatti Type 57SC Atlantic of 1936, with its riveted dorsal seam and its teardrop coupe profile designed by Jean Bugatti, remains arguably the most beautiful and certainly one of the most valuable cars ever built—a machine that transcends its function to become sculpture.
The Alfa Romeo 8C 2900B, built from 1937 to 1939 with voluptuous Touring Superleggera bodywork draped over a supercharged 2.9-liter straight-eight engine, represented the absolute pinnacle of pre-war sports-car engineering, combining prodigious performance with a level of aesthetic refinement that has never been surpassed. The 1939 Lagonda V12, designed under the leadership of W.O. Bentley after his departure from the company that still bore his name, was among the finest British cars of the immediate pre-war period and a demonstration that Bentley had lost none of his engineering genius in the transition from one company to another.
Post-War Renaissance: 1945 to 1965
The post-war period witnessed the emergence of the production sports car as a distinct and vibrant market segment. Jaguar’s XK120, launched in 1948 with a 3.4-liter dual-overhead-camshaft straight-six engine and voluptuous bodywork styled by Malcolm Sayer, an aerodynamicist who applied aircraft-design principles to automobile styling with breathtaking results, was the fastest production car in the world at its launch at 120 miles per hour—hence the name—and it established Jaguar’s enduring reputation for combining speed, beauty, and relative affordability in a package that no competitor could match. The Mercedes-Benz 300SL Gullwing of 1954, derived directly from the W194 racing car that had won the 1952 Carrera Panamericana and the 24 Hours of Le Mans, featured innovative direct fuel injection, upward-opening gullwing doors necessitated by the tall sills of its space-frame chassis, and a top speed exceeding 160 miles per hour that made it the fastest production car of its era.
In Italy, Enzo Ferrari—a former Alfa Romeo racing driver and team manager who had started his own company in 1947 after the war—was building the legend that would come to define the ultimate in automotive desirability. The 1947 Ferrari 125 S, powered by a 1.5-liter V12 designed by the brilliant engineer Gioacchino Colombo, was the first car to bear the Ferrari name. The 250 series that followed—the 250 MM, the 250 GT Tour de France, the 250 GT SWB (Short Wheelbase) Berlinetta, the 250 GT Lusso, and the ultimate expression of the line, the 250 GTO—established Ferrari as the dominant force in GT racing and the most coveted marque in collector circles worldwide. The GTO’s production run of 36 cars between 1962 and 1964 has become, through the alchemy of racing success, design excellence, and extreme rarity, the most valuable series-produced automobile in history.
In America, the Chevrolet Corvette debuted in 1953 as a fiberglass-bodied six-cylinder roadster that was more a styling exercise than a serious sports car. It was the 1955 introduction of the small-block V8, an engine designed under the leadership of Ed Cole, Zora Arkus-Duntov, and a team of engineers who created what would become the most versatile and widely used performance engine in American history, that transformed the Corvette into a genuine sports car. The Ford Thunderbird, introduced in 1955 as Ford’s response to the Corvette but conceived from the beginning as a personal luxury car rather than an outright sports car, evolved through multiple generations to define a uniquely American automotive genre.
The Muscle Car Era: 1964 to 1972
The muscle car era, ignited by the 1964 Pontiac GTO—essentially a Tempest LeMans intermediate coupe with a 389-cubic-inch V8 that Pontiac’s leadership had slipped past General Motors’ corporate prohibition on large engines in intermediate cars by offering it as an option package rather than a separate model—defined American automotive performance for a generation and created an entire category of vehicles that would become among the most collectible American cars ever produced. The formula was brilliantly simple and devastatingly effective: an intermediate-sized car with the largest available V8, optimized for straight-line acceleration, priced within reach of young buyers. The Ford Mustang, conceived by the visionary executive Lee Iacocca and launched in April of 1964 to a reception that exceeded even Ford’s most optimistic projections, launched the pony car segment and sold an astonishing 418,000 units in its first year of production.
By 1968 through 1970, the muscle-car wars reached their absolute zenith in a crescendo of displacement that seemed to escalate with every model year. The Dodge Charger R/T with the 440 Magnum and the near-mythical 426 Hemi. The Chevrolet Chevelle SS 454 LS6, officially rated at 450 horsepower but widely understood within the industry to be significantly underrated to appease insurance companies. The Plymouth Road Runner 426 Hemi and the homologation-special Hemi ‘Cuda that would become, decades later, the most valuable American muscle cars in existence. The Buick GSX Stage 1 with its monstrous 510 pound-feet of torque from a 455-cubic-inch V8. These cars delivered levels of straight-line performance that American manufacturers would not match for over three decades. The 1971 oil embargo, soaring insurance premiums for high-performance vehicles, and the first wave of federal emissions regulations killed the muscle-car era almost overnight. By 1973, the Mustang II—a modest Pinto-based economy car—symbolized the retreat from performance that would define the American industry for the remainder of the decade.
The Supercar Emergence: 1966 to 2005
While Detroit was building muscle cars for the drag strip, Europe was creating the supercar for the open road. The 1966 Lamborghini Miura, with its transversely mounted 3.9-liter V12 and breathtaking Bertone body designed by the young Marcello Gandini, is universally regarded as the first supercar—a mid-engine, two-seat exotic whose layout, proportions, and philosophy established a template that every supercar since has followed. The 1971 Lamborghini Countach prototype, the LP500, and the production LP400 that followed in 1974, with its scissor doors and origami-wedge shape that looked like nothing else on the road, defined the supercar aesthetic for an entire generation.
The 1987 Porsche 959 was a technological tour de force that redefined what a road car could be: twin-turbocharged 2.85-liter flat-six, all-wheel drive with variable torque distribution, electronically adjustable ride height and damping, magnesium wheels with hollow spokes containing tire-pressure sensors, and a top speed of 197 miles per hour. The Ferrari F40, launched in the same year to celebrate Enzo Ferrari’s 40th anniversary as a constructor, was the last car personally approved by the founder before his death in 1988. Twin-turbocharged V8, composite body panels, no carpet, no door handles, no sound deadening, no concessions to comfort of any kind, and a top speed of 201 miles per hour—the first production car to breach the 200-mile-per-hour barrier.
The 1993 McLaren F1, designed by Gordon Murray with a central driving position, a carbon-fiber monocoque, a naturally aspirated 6.1-liter BMW V12 producing 627 horsepower, and a gold-foil-lined engine bay, set a production-car speed record of 240.1 miles per hour that stood for over a decade. The 2005 Bugatti Veyron, with its quad-turbocharged W16 engine producing 1,001 horsepower, demonstrated that the pursuit of ever-higher performance was alive and accelerating. Each of these cars, once dismissed as merely “used exotics,” is now recognized as a modern classic whose values reflect their historical significance.
